HI MACS®
Distributed exclusively in the UK and Ireland by James Latham, HI-MACS® solid surface is a highly versatile and extremely durable material which can be easily machined and thermoformed to almost any 3D-shape imaginable, offering endless design possibilities and producing a surface that is flowing, functional and visually seamless.

Even large-area installations have the appearance of a single application and this non-porous, completely smooth surface means that liquid penetration is practically impossible, making it completely sterile, easy to clean and repair – therefore creating the perfect base for germ-free areas.

HI-MACS® has been granted a specialist hygiene certificate, which means it is particularly well suited for use in kitchen environments and these exceptional technical features mean it will not look tired or deteriorate in terms of its appearance or performance.

One of the major attractions of HI-MACS® is the extensive choice of colours on offer. There are almost 100 in the portfolio, with sixty two of these being suitable for kitchen applications. Supplied in thicknesses of 12mm, 9mm and 6mm, the range now also includes 22 designs of sinks – available in over 60 colours.

Shinnoki 2.0
James Latham is now offering Shinnoki 2.0, a range of ready to use veneered panels that are supplied already stained and lacquered, requiring no further finishing.

With Shinnoki, the veneer is applied to an MDF base, rendering the panels sturdy and easy to use. In addition, the panels are produced in both a single or double sided finish, with the first having a melamine faced-reverse. The veneers are mismatched, but stained and textured to create a consistent finish that shows the natural aspects and beauty of the species.

The extensive Shinnoki 2.0 range is supplied in designs which are completely in tune with current design trends within the kitchen sector and includes matching realwood and ABS edge banding. The 17 designs are also supplied in separate 3-ply veneer sheets, perfect for curved surfaces as well as doors or other interior requirements.

Mirror Gloss
Part of the Kronodesign range, Mirror Gloss comprises 20 highly durable, scratch resistant, light and colorfast decors that include 14 sparkling gloss colours, four wood grains and two fantasy decors.

Mirror Gloss pushes the boundaries of depth and definition, colour and reflective gloss and is produced using first class particleboard and high quality melamine film, achieving a gloss level of 140 points for decorative use in the hospitality, interior design and furniture making industries.

The perfect application for Mirror Gloss MFC is surfaces in kitchens, bedrooms and bathrooms as well as fine luxury retailing and shop fitting, domestic spaces, home and office furnishings.
